Over time your vehicles air conditioning system may begin to show signs of wear and as with any vehicle system it is always best to stay on top of maintenance to prevent further issues or possible failures. Some easy indicators to identify when your vehicles air conditioning system needs attention are:
It takes a prolonged period of time to cool the interior which may suggest a refrigerant gas leak
Leaking water from under the dashboard
Weak airflow from vents
Foul odours or balmy air coming from air vents
Air conditioning compressor clutch not moving
Grinding or bearing noise from compressor
Whilst all of these are annoying, and some easier to fix than others, it pays to heed these signs and look to get your air conditioning serviced and in good working condition. A loss of refrigerant gas from the system not only contributes to poor cooling it also deprives the air conditioning system of lubricants carried by this gas to keep seals from becoming dry and leaking.
